WebOct 26, 2015 · Peer debriefing is a technique used by many qualitative researchers for multiple reasons. While sociologists favor this term, many other fields use other signifiers to achieve the same purpose and meaning. For example, words like outside reader, auditor, and peer reviewer are essentially describing the work of peer debriefing.
